Obliteration starts with targeted baiting systems or direct dust applications that make use of the natural grooming habits of the colony. Foraging employees consume the specialised non repellent chemical matrix and inadvertently move the active components throughout the below ground network ultimately reaching the queen. This systemic elimination process ensures that the entire colony is neutralised rather than simply warding off the insects to another section of the structural framing. As soon as the active invasion is entirely eradicated professionals move their primary focus towards establishing a robust long term chemical protective zone around the entire external border of the structure foundation.
Boundary soil management involves the careful application of liquid termiticides into the trenches excavated around the external concrete piece or underlying strip footings. In locations where concrete paths or driveways abut the primary structural walls accurate drilling methods are utilised to inject the chemical barrier straight into the sub flooring soil zones. These modern chemical formulations are designed to bind firmly with regional soil particles creating an undetectable zone that foraging insects can not permeate. Alternatively many property owners in the area choose to set up specific monitoring and baiting stations at regular intervals around their limit lines. These border stations are inspected regularly by specialists to obstruct foraging colonies well before they approach the primary residential structure.

Property owners can likewise take practical preventative procedures such as keeping clear weep holes guaranteeing appropriate sub flooring ventilation and fixing any leaking garden taps or drain issues next to external walls.
